Troubleshooting Questions and Answers:
1. Question: Why is my Quickcam Zoom not being recognized by my Windows 10 computer?
Answer: Ensure that the Quickcam Zoom driver is installed correctly. Go to the manufacturer's website and download the latest Windows 10 driver for the Quickcam Zoom. Once downloaded, install the driver and restart your computer. If the issue persists, try using a different USB port or cable.
2. Question: Why is the image quality of my Quickcam Zoom blurry?
Answer: Check if the lens of the camera is clean and free from any smudges or dirt. Use a soft cloth to gently clean the lens. Also, make sure that the zoom feature is not set to its maximum limit, as excessive zoom can result in reduced image quality. Adjust the zoom level as per your requirement for optimal clarity.
3. Question: Why does my Quickcam Zoom freeze or lag during video calls?
Answer: This issue could be related to insufficient system resources or conflicts with other webcam applications. Close any unnecessary programs running in the background to free up system resources. Additionally, make sure that no other applications are accessing the webcam simultaneously. If the problem persists, try reinstalling the Quickcam Zoom driver or contacting the manufacturer for further assistance.
